- Interview applicants to determine eligibility for multiple state and federal programs.
- Review applications and documents for program benefits, long-term care services and payments.
- Explain applicant rights and responsibilities.
- Make appropriate referrals to other ODHS programs and resources.
- Complete redetermination, periodic reviews, and change updates within federal timeframes and within appropriate intervals.
- Ensure appropriate documentation and forms are completed and sent, information is captured correctly, and actions taken are notated.
- Ensure that service delivery is provided in a culturally competent way; provide communication to Oregonians in their preferred language/format by utilizing printed materials available in different languages/formats and use of language services available.
- Problem solves issues that Oregonians or other staff may have around their case and eligibility.
- Work with individuals over the phone, through virtual video conferencing, through chat, email, and by processing tasks related to eligibility determinations.

These positions are bilingual and requires duties to be done in both English and Vietnamese. Job offer will be contingent upon passing test(s) evaluating your proficiency in the bilingual requirements of the position.Bilingual differential pay is provided to positions that require to use a language other than English to fulfill their job duties within their position.
Bilingual differential pay is 5% of the employee's base pay.Work Schedule for these positions:
Opportunity Awaits, Apply Today We're in search of TWO (2) talented and driven individuals who have experience interviewing applicants to determine eligibility, knowledge of State and Federal policies and procedures, excellent Spanish verbal, and written communications skills to take on a key role in our team as a Bilingual Vietnamese, Eligibility Worker for the Oregon Eligibility Partnership, part of the Oregon Department of Human Services.
In this role you will, perform eligibility determinations, redeterminations, periodic reviews, and updates to changes for the following ODHS, OHA, and DELC programs: Supplemental Nutrition Assistance Program (SNAP), Oregon Health Plan (OHP), Medicaid Long-Term Care Financial Eligibility Benefits, Medicare Savings Plans (MSP), Employment Related Day Care (ERDC), Temporary Assistance for Needy Families (TANF), Temporary Assistance for Domestic Violence Survivors (TA- DVS) and other cash benefits.
In addition to determine eligibility for these programs, eligibility works are responsible for accurate and timely determinations across the state to ensure recipients meet program requirement for all OEP programs.
ABOUT Oregon Eligibility Partnership
As an employee working within Oregon Eligibility Partnership (OEP), you will provide direction and resources to everyone working to determine eligibility for Oregonians applying for and receiving medical, food, cash and childcare benefits through the ONE Eligibility System.
You will be a critical part of the eligibility process that moves beyond integration and equality, to focus on equity of services and providing timely, accurate, and necessary eligibility determinations through a person-centered approach.
